@@ -65,9 +65,11 @@ describe('commandListSecrets', () => {
65
65
cwd : dataDir ,
66
66
} ) ;
67
67
expect ( result . exitCode ) . toBe ( 0 ) ;
68
- expect ( result . stdout ) . toBe (
69
- `${ secretName1 } \n${ secretName2 } \n${ secretName3 } \n` ,
70
- ) ;
68
+ expect ( result . stdout . trim ( ) . split ( '\n' ) ) . toEqual ( [
69
+ secretName1 ,
70
+ secretName2 ,
71
+ secretName3 ,
72
+ ] ) ;
71
73
} ) ;
72
74
test ( 'should list secrets' , async ( ) => {
73
75
const vaultName = 'vault' as VaultName ;
@@ -86,9 +88,11 @@ describe('commandListSecrets', () => {
86
88
cwd : dataDir ,
87
89
} ) ;
88
90
expect ( result . exitCode ) . toBe ( 0 ) ;
89
- expect ( result . stdout ) . toBe (
90
- `${ secretName1 } \n${ secretName2 } \n${ secretName3 } \n` ,
91
- ) ;
91
+ expect ( result . stdout . trim ( ) . split ( '\n' ) ) . toEqual ( [
92
+ secretName1 ,
93
+ secretName2 ,
94
+ secretName3 ,
95
+ ] ) ;
92
96
} ) ;
93
97
test ( 'should fail when path is not a directory' , async ( ) => {
94
98
const vaultName = 'vault' as VaultName ;
@@ -141,7 +145,10 @@ describe('commandListSecrets', () => {
141
145
cwd : dataDir ,
142
146
} ) ;
143
147
expect ( result . exitCode ) . toBe ( 0 ) ;
144
- expect ( result . stdout ) . toBe ( `${ secretDirName1 } \n${ nestedDir } \n` ) ;
148
+ expect ( result . stdout . trim ( ) . split ( '\n' ) ) . toEqual ( [
149
+ nestedDir ,
150
+ secretDirName1 ,
151
+ ] ) ;
145
152
command = [ 'secrets' , 'ls' , '-np' , dataDir , `${ vaultName } :${ nestedDir } ` ] ;
146
153
result = await testUtils . pkStdio ( command , {
147
154
env : { PK_PASSWORD : password } ,
0 commit comments